Write When You Can’t Travel This year it will be historically expensive to travel during November, December, and January, which may mean that you won’t get to spend as much time with family and friends as you would like. Hand written letters are a great way to reach out with warm thoughts and Holiday memories even if you can’t be there in person. Do you usually go on a weeklong January ski trip with your cousins, but it’s just not possible this year? Write a note sharing happy memories of years past, and include your hopes that you’ll all be able to pick up the tradition where it left off next year.
